Marcelino: Although the team was very aggressive in physical duels, their performance in ball control was still lacking.
2026-05-11 13:28
Villarreal head coach Marcelino García Toral analyzed the team's 1-1 draw against Real Mallorca at a press conference held at the Somoix Stadium. This result further solidified Villarreal's third-place position in the league standings.
Marcelino García Toral stated, "We hope to finish the season in third place; that's our goal. This point gives us a six-point lead, and there are still nine points to fight for in the season. In the final round, we will also face Atlético Madrid directly."
“Throughout the match, we didn’t lack intensity in physical duels, but our ball control wasn’t ideal. We failed to win enough physical battles in the attacking third, and our final pass was also lacking in quality. Real Mallorca is a very aggressive high-pressing team; they will force you to build up play near your own penalty area.”
"The weather was quite hot, which did have some impact on the game, but we had anticipated that before the match. Both teams' players put in a tremendous effort, and their performances deserve recognition."
Speaking about the upcoming match against Sevilla, Marcelino García Toral said the team's goals are clear. He stated, "We want to win to move closer to third place. We're back at home, and we've been consistently strong there. Sevilla are also fighting for multiple goals, and although they've recently won and have a better chance of avoiding relegation, we still have to win to achieve our objectives."
